We are pleased to offer this 1997 Porsche 993 Carrera Cabriolet finished in Wimbledon Green Metallic over a Classic Grey interior.  In addition to its striking and exceedingly rare paint color, this 993 was ordered with the exclusive Aluminum/Chrome Package as well as a 6-speed manual transmission, limited-slip differential, Automatic Brake Differential (ABD), and Turbo-style 18” hollow-spoke wheels.  It was acquired by the seller from its original owner in 2002 and has been routinely maintained ever since including replacement of the valve cover gaskets.  Having spent much of its life in New Jersey, this 993 has recently moved to California with its longtime owner where it is now being offered for auction with approximately 43k miles on the odometer.

This 993 was special ordered in the eye-catching shade of Wimbledon Green, a rarely seen color named for the world-famous tennis championship which Porsche had sponsored over the years.  It also features the exclusive oval stainless-steel tailpipes (X54) included with the Aluminum/Chrome Package.  This Cabriolet comes fitted with a Classic Grey retractable soft top and matching tonneau cover.  A small crack is depicted on the rear bumper, additional images are provided in the gallery along with paint meter readings and a clean CARFAX report.  This 993 was factory equipped with optional Turbo-style 18” Technology hollow-spoke wheels which are currently dressed in Continental ContiSportContact 3 tires.

Inside, you will find a Classic Grey and black partial leather interior with stainless steel door entry guards and aluminum-look instrument dials included with the Aluminum/Chrome Package as well as an exclusive shift knob and parking brake lever in aluminum.  The original radio has been upgraded to a Porsche CDR-210 unit and the specifications label on the underside of the hood lists the following factory options:

This 993 is equipped with an air-cooled 3.6L flat-six Varioram engine that sends up to 282 HP and 250 lb.-ft of torque to the rear wheels by way of a 6-speed manual transmission with an optional limited-slip differential and Automatic Brake Differential (ABD).  The hood and rear decklid struts are said to have been recently replaced and the car is described to have been kept up to date on all routine maintenance under the current ownership.  A collection of invoices is provided for reference in the gallery.

This sale will include the original toolkit, jack, air pump, cabin wind deflector, service records, and a clean title. Appointed from the factory with some of the rarest and most desirable options available, this stunning 993 Cabriolet awaits its next owner.
